SibFU student’s designer collection to be presented at Rome Fashion Week

A graduate of the SibFU School of Architecture and Design Victoria Nizheradze is to show her collection “Mukhoslon” at the Fashion Week in Rome (Italy). The clothes together with a research work have become a part of her diploma project “A dress as a metaphor”.

The creator of the collection Victoria Nizheradze says: “This is a conceptual collection. The main message is to show the way people often exaggerate, making an elephant out of a fly* (the Russian word Mukhoslon is an integration of the words Fly and Elephant). For example, a transparent raincoat says that life is actually much simpler and clearer than we think”.
The designer received an invitation to come to Italy after a regional fashion contest where she took the 2nd place. The examination board also gave the highest appraisal to the collection, noting its particular artistic and designer performance, and recommended the work to be presented at an annual international show of the best diploma projects МООСАО .

According to the Head of the Chair of Design at SibFU School of Architecture and Design Tatyana Simanzhenkova, each graduation work this year raised a serious discussion on the most relevant topics, such as social and cultural aspects in the modern dress. Some designer graduates wanted through their clothes to give people incentive for reading classical literature, while others created collections for orphans or developed the idea of the modern sub-cultural dress.

The following graduation collections have also been marked for the high level of performance:
• “Musthave Literature” by Sophia Mikhalchenko (dress as a means of popularization of classical Russian literature);
• “Phantom of aristocracy” by Nina Bolshakova (medieval gothic trends in the modern design).
